Lisa Maffia, a prominent member of the early 2000s UK garage group So Solid Crew, rose to fame with hits like the platinum-selling '21 Seconds' and has since diversified her career as a musician, salon owner, and interior designer. In late 2021, Maffia openly shared her hair transplant journey on Instagram, revealing that years of tight hairstyling and hair extensions had significantly damaged her hairline. At 42 years old, she underwent a hair restoration procedure in London, with follicles transplanted from the back of her head to her front hairline to encourage new growth. Documenting her experience graphically, Maffia posted before-and-after images showing the healing process, emphasizing that the procedure was minimally painful and transformative. Following her transplant, Maffia has been transparent about her experience, encouraging others to consider the procedure if they're experiencing similar hair loss. She described the treatment as life-changing and highlighted the importance of choosing a reputable clinic. Her openness about the procedure has drawn attention to hair restoration options for women experiencing styling-related hair damage, turning her personal experience into a potential resource for others facing similar challenges.
